What is Laser Teeth Whitening?

Laser teeth whitening is a modern dental procedure that uses laser energy to activate a whitening gel applied to the teeth. The high-powered laser accelerates bleaching, breaking down stains and discoloration to reveal a brighter smile. It is particularly favored for its quick results, often achieving noticeable whitening in a single session.

What are the reasons for yellow and discolored teeth?

Yellow and discolored teeth are common dental concerns that can affect the appearance of a person's smile. These changes in tooth color can result from various intrinsic and extrinsic factors. Understanding the causes can help manage and prevent discoloration effectively.

1. Extrinsic Factors

Extrinsic discoloration occurs on the outer surface of the teeth and is often caused by external elements:

  • Dietary Habits: Frequent consumption of staining substances such as coffee, tea, red wine, soda, and dark-colored foods can lead to discoloration over time.
  • Tobacco Use: Smoking or chewing tobacco is a major contributor to yellowing and staining of teeth.
  • Poor Oral Hygiene: Inadequate brushing and flossing allow plaque and tartar build-up, which can cause teeth to appear yellow or dull.

2. Intrinsic Factors

Intrinsic discolouration originates within the tooth structure and is typically more challenging to treat:

  • Ageing: As people age, the enamel (outer layer of the teeth) naturally wears down, revealing the yellowish dentin underneath.
  • Medication: Certain antibiotics, such as tetracycline and doxycycline, taken during tooth development can lead to intrinsic stains. Additionally, some antihistamines, antipsychotics, and high blood pressure medications may cause discolouration.
  • Fluorosis: Excessive fluoride intake during childhood, when teeth develop, can result in white or brown spots on the enamel.
  • Dental Trauma: Injury to a tooth can damage its pulp, leading to discoloration over time.

3. Genetic and Developmental Factors

  • Genetics: Some individuals naturally have thicker or thinner enamel, which can influence the appearance of their teeth.
  • Enamel Hypoplasia: A condition where the enamel does not form properly during development, making teeth more prone to discoloration.

4. Lifestyle and Environmental Factors

  • Acidic Foods and Beverages: Acidic substances can erode enamel, making teeth more susceptible to staining.
  • Chlorinated Water: Prolonged exposure to improperly maintained chlorinated pools can cause enamel erosion and discoloration.
  • Health Conditions: Certain medical conditions, such as jaundice in infants or metabolic disorders, can affect tooth colour.

 

Laser teeth whitening procedure

Initial Consultation

  • The process begins with a thorough examination by a dental professional to assess your oral health and determine whether you are a suitable candidate for laser teeth whitening.
  • Dental issues, such as cavities or gum disease, must be treated before the whitening procedure.

Teeth Cleaning

  • The dentist performs a professional cleaning to remove plaque and tartar, ensuring the whitening agents can effectively penetrate the tooth surface.

Preparation for Whitening

  • A protective barrier, such as a rubber dam or gel, shields the gums and surrounding soft tissues from the whitening agent and laser exposure.
  • Safety goggles are provided to protect your eyes from the laser light.

Application of Whitening Gel

  • A specialized whitening gel, usually containing hydrogen peroxide or carbamide peroxide, is evenly applied to the surface of the teeth.
  • The concentration of the gel is higher than that found in over-the-counter products, allowing for faster and more effective results.

Activation with Laser Light

  • A dental laser is used to activate the whitening gel. The laser's energy accelerates the breakdown of stain molecules, enhancing the whitening process.
  • The laser application is typically done in short intervals, with the dentist monitoring the process to ensure safety and effectiveness.

Final Rinse and Evaluation

  • After the desired shade of whiteness is achieved, the whitening gel is removed, and the teeth are thoroughly rinsed.
  • The dentist evaluates the results and may provide aftercare instructions to maintain the brightness.

How long does laser teeth whitening last?

Laser teeth whitening results can last anywhere from 6 months to 3 years, depending on several factors, including individual habits, oral hygiene, and lifestyle choices. To maintain your results, avoiding foods and drinks that can stain your teeth, like coffee and wine, is advisable.

Advantages and Disadvantages of laser teeth whitening:

Advantages:

  • Immediate Results: Teeth can appear several shades whiter after just one session.
  • Safe and Minimally Invasive: The non-surgical procedure requires no recovery time.
  • Effective for Surface Stains: Laser whitening is highly effective in removing surface stains caused by food and tobacco.

Disadvantages:

  • Higher Cost: Laser teeth whitening is generally more expensive than over-the-counter or at-home whitening products.
  • Temporary Sensitivity: Some individuals may experience mild tooth sensitivity for a few days after treatment.
  • Limited Effectiveness for Deep Stains: Laser whitening may be less effective for discoloration caused by internal factors like medication or trauma.
